excel表格怎么移动列行

excel表格怎么移动列行

Excel表格中移动列行的方法包括:使用剪切和粘贴、拖动列行、更改列行顺序、使用排序功能。 下面将详细介绍其中一种方法:拖动列行。这种方法简单直观,适用于大多数情况。首先,选中需要移动的列或行,然后将鼠标悬停在选中区域的边缘,光标变为十字箭头时,按住左键并拖动到目标位置,松开鼠标即可完成移动。

一、使用剪切和粘贴

1、剪切和粘贴的基本操作

首先,选中要移动的列或行。你可以点击列标或行号来选中整个列或行。然后,右键点击选中的区域,选择“剪切”选项,或者使用快捷键Ctrl+X进行剪切。接下来,选择目标位置,右键点击并选择“插入剪切的单元格”,或者使用快捷键Ctrl+V进行粘贴。这样就完成了列或行的移动。

2、注意事项

在使用剪切和粘贴时,要注意目标位置的现有数据。如果目标位置已经有数据,Excel会提示你是否覆盖这些数据。因此,在剪切和粘贴前,确保目标位置是空的或者不重要的数据。此外,使用剪切和粘贴时要注意保持数据的一致性,避免因为移动导致数据错位。

二、拖动列行

1、拖动列的步骤

拖动列是一种非常直观的移动方法。首先,选中需要移动的列,鼠标指针会变成一个黑色的十字箭头。按住鼠标左键,将选中的列拖动到目标位置,然后松开鼠标即可。Excel会自动调整其他列的位置,以适应新的列顺序。

2、拖动行的步骤

拖动行的步骤与拖动列类似。选中需要移动的行,鼠标指针会变成一个黑色的十字箭头。按住鼠标左键,将选中的行拖动到目标位置,然后松开鼠标。Excel会自动调整其他行的位置,以适应新的行顺序。

三、更改列行顺序

1、使用鼠标拖动列行

使用鼠标拖动列行是更改列行顺序的常见方法。首先,选中需要移动的列或行。然后,将鼠标悬停在选中区域的边缘,光标变成一个四向箭头时,按住左键并拖动到目标位置,松开鼠标即可完成移动。这样可以快速调整列行的顺序。

2、使用剪切和粘贴更改顺序

另一种更改列行顺序的方法是使用剪切和粘贴。首先,选中需要移动的列或行,使用Ctrl+X进行剪切。接下来,选择目标位置,使用Ctrl+V进行粘贴。这样可以将选中的列或行移动到新的位置,从而更改顺序。

四、使用排序功能

1、按列排序

Excel提供了强大的排序功能,可以根据某一列的数据对整个表格进行排序。首先,选中需要排序的列,然后在“数据”选项卡中选择“排序”功能。可以选择升序或降序排序。Excel会自动调整其他列的数据,以保持行之间的对应关系。

2、按行排序

虽然Excel主要是按列排序,但也可以通过一些技巧实现按行排序。首先,将行数据转换为列数据,即使用“转置”功能。然后,对转换后的列数据进行排序。排序完成后,再次使用“转置”功能将数据恢复为行数据。这样就实现了按行排序。

五、使用宏和VBA

1、录制宏

对于需要频繁移动列行的操作,可以使用Excel的宏功能。首先,录制一个宏,记录下移动列行的操作步骤。然后,每次需要移动列行时,只需运行录制的宏即可。这样可以大大提高工作效率。

2、编写VBA代码

对于复杂的移动操作,可以编写VBA代码来实现。VBA(Visual Basic for Applications)是Excel的编程语言,可以用于自动化任务。通过编写VBA代码,可以实现对列行的精确控制,从而完成复杂的移动操作。

六、使用Power Query

1、导入数据到Power Query

Power Query是Excel中的一个强大工具,可以用来处理和整理数据。首先,将数据导入到Power Query中。然后,在Power Query编辑器中,可以使用各种功能对列行进行移动和调整。处理完成后,将数据加载回Excel表格中。

2、使用Power Query移动列行

在Power Query编辑器中,可以通过拖动列标来移动列的位置。对于行,可以使用“排序”功能来调整顺序。此外,还可以使用“筛选”、“删除重复项”等功能来整理数据。Power Query提供了丰富的功能,可以满足各种复杂的需求。

七、使用第三方工具

1、探索第三方工具

除了Excel自带的功能,还有许多第三方工具可以用来移动和整理Excel中的列行。这些工具通常提供了更强大的功能和更友好的界面,可以大大提高工作效率。可以根据具体需求选择合适的工具。

2、集成第三方工具

一些第三方工具可以与Excel集成使用,从而实现更高效的操作。例如,可以使用一些数据处理工具来批量移动列行,然后将结果导入到Excel中。通过集成第三方工具,可以充分利用各种工具的优势,完成复杂的任务。

八、常见问题及解决方法

1、数据丢失

在移动列行时,可能会遇到数据丢失的问题。通常这是因为目标位置已经有数据,导致覆盖了原有数据。为避免这种情况,可以先检查目标位置是否为空,或者将目标位置的数据临时保存到其他地方。

2、数据错位

数据错位是另一种常见问题,通常是因为移动操作不准确导致的。为避免数据错位,可以使用Excel提供的对齐功能,确保列行之间的数据保持一致。此外,在移动前可以先备份数据,以防出现问题时可以恢复。

3、公式失效

在移动列行时,某些公式可能会失效,特别是涉及到相对引用的公式。为避免公式失效,可以在移动前将公式转换为数值,或者使用绝对引用。此外,可以检查移动后的公式是否正确,并进行必要的调整。

总结来说,移动Excel表格中的列行有多种方法,包括剪切和粘贴、拖动列行、更改列行顺序、使用排序功能等。每种方法都有其优缺点,可以根据具体情况选择合适的方法。掌握这些技巧,可以大大提高工作效率,完成各种复杂的数据处理任务。

相关问答FAQs:

1. 如何在Excel表格中移动列?
在Excel表格中移动列非常简单。只需选中要移动的列,然后将鼠标放置在选中列的边界上,光标会变成十字箭头。按住鼠标左键拖动列到新的位置,然后松开鼠标即可完成移动。

2. 如何在Excel表格中移动行?
移动行与移动列类似。选中要移动的行,将鼠标放置在选中行的边界上,光标会变成十字箭头。按住鼠标左键拖动行到新的位置,然后松开鼠标即可完成移动。

3. 如何在Excel表格中交换两列的位置?
如果想要交换两列的位置,可以使用“剪切”和“粘贴”功能来实现。首先,选中第一列,点击右键选择“剪切”或按下Ctrl+X进行剪切。然后,选中第二列,点击右键选择“插入剪贴板”或按下Ctrl+V进行粘贴。这样就能够实现两列的位置交换了。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4876427

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部